Responsibility
- Process and manage incoming payments, ensuring accurate posting to customer accounts.
- Monitor and reconcile accounts receivable aging reports to minimize overdue balances.
- Prepare and send professional invoices, statements, and payment reminders to clients.
- Collaborate with the sales and customer service teams to resolve billing discrepancies and disputes.
- Maintain up-to-date and accurate records of all financial transactions in the ERP system.
- Generate and analyze AR reports to identify trends and recommend process improvements.
- Assist in month-end and year-end closing activities, including reconciliations and audits.
- Communicate proactively with clients to ensure timely payments and address any concerns.
